The property

This semi-detached cottage sits close to the centre of Windermere, just a short wander from a range of amenities and attractions, in the Lake District.

Delightfully presented with an enclosed rear garden, woodburning stove and off-road parking, Ananda House is a wonderful retreat for a family and their pet looking to spend some time in the Lakelands.

After parking up directly outside, head through the door into the lounge, where you can kick back beside the woodburner and choose a film from the Smart TV. Allow the designated chef to become acquainted in the kitchen, making use of the electric oven and ceramic hob, microwave, fridge, freezer, dishwasher and even a washer/dryer, perfect for keeping on top of your laundry.

Continue outside to the rear garden, where you can bask in the evening sun with a favourite tipple in hand, set in an enclosed space so your furry friend can safely explore.

Whisk away upstairs and make yourself comfortable in the bedrooms, complete with a super-king-size with Smart TV, a double and a 4’ 3” double, each neutrally presented.

Completing the interior is the shower room, ideal for freshening up before heading out the door.

Explore Windermere high street with its range of independent shops selling local produce, traditional butchers, restaurants and pubs, offering something for everyone.

Head to National Trust's Wray Castle, take a walk through Brockhole on Windermere, or learn about the area's rich history at the Lake District Visitor Centre.

Five miles away lies Ambleside, an idyllic town home to the Ambleside Roman Fort, a must-see for keen historians, whilst there is also the Bridge House and the beautiful Stock Ghyll Force worth adding to the itinerary. Escape to the Lake District with a relaxing stay at Ananda House.

About the location

WINDERMERE

Ambleside 5 miles; Kendal 8.7 miles.

The twin towns of Bowness and Windermere are both vibrant, fun-filled places set within the splendid scenery of the Lake District. Both towns provide a range of amenities, shops and restaurants to suit all tastes whilst Ambleside offers the additional attraction of a boat ride to Bowness, the Lakeside Aquarium and Beatrix Potter's 'Hill Top House' at Sawrey. Grizedale Forest Park is within easy driving distance and is home to a range of activities including many good walks, mountain biking and the 'Go Ape' adventure park. The region also boasts many National Trust properties as well as a variety of water sports for those who prefer a more adrenaline-fuelled trip. Children will enjoy a trip to the 'World of Beatrix Potter' in Bowness whilst the villages of Grasmere, Coniston Water, Kendal, Keswick and the Lakeland Mountains are all within easy reach.
